WASHINGTON, D.C. - APRIL 19, 2018: A marble statue of Po'pay by native American artist Cliff Fragua stands in the U.S. Capitol Visitor Center in Washington, D.C. Po'pay was born circa 1630 in the San Juan Pueblo, in what is now the state of New Mexico. In 1680 he organized the Pueblo Revolt against the Spanish. (Photo by Robert Alexander/Getty Images)
